Decluttering your home can be a daunting task, but it doesn't have to be stressful. By breaking it down into smaller, manageable actions, you can achieve a more organized and peaceful living space. Here's a 10-step guide to help you declutter your home effortlessly.


Step 1: Set a Goal and Schedule
Before you start decluttering, it's essential to set a defined goal and schedule for the task. Decide which areas of your home you want to focus on first, and set a definite date to start and finish the decluttering process. This will help you stay motivated throughout the process.


Step 2: Gather Supplies
To make decluttering easier, gather the necessary tools beforehand. You'll need storage containers, a marker, and some baskets. Having these supplies on hand will save you time and make the process more efficient.


Step 3: Start with a Small Area
Begin by choosing a small space, such as a cupboard, to focus on. This will make it less overwhelming to declutter and help you build steam. Once you've decluttered the small area, move on to a larger area, like a closet.


Step 4: Sort Items into Categories
When decluttering, sort items into categories, such as trash. Be honest with yourself about each item - if you haven't used it in a age, it's probably safe to get rid of it. Consider the 20 rule, where 20% of the time, you only use 20% of your belongings.


Step 5: Let Go of Unwanted Items

Step 6: Organize What Remains
Once you've decluttered, it's time to categorize what remains. Use storage containers to keep items organized. Consider investing in shelving to keep your belongings off the floor and out of sight.


Step 7: Create a Maintenance Routine
Creating a regular maintenance routine will help you stay on top of clutter and prevent it from building up in the eventually. Set aside time each week to organize and put away items that are out of place.


Step 8: Don't Forget the Hidden Areas
Hidden areas, such as cupboards, can be a hiding place for clutter. Don't forget to declutter these areas, too. Take everything out and sort through it, and consider using folders to keep items accessible.


Step 9: Consider the 1-Touch Rule
The 1-touch rule states that you should try to put things away in their proper spot the first time you use them. This will save you effort and make decluttering a breeze and keep your home neat.


Step 10: Take Care of Yourself
Decluttering can be physically exhausting, so make sure to take care yourself throughout the process. Take pauses, stay hydrated, and get enough sleep. Reward yourself with treats that bring you happiness and make you feel relaxed.
